All you need is a our GMG WC-GT headers and center section.

The CUP system is not a good option for a road car as the there are no mufflers and they are needed in order to not loose power.

Cup cars run a completely different intake, valve train and do not run variocam.

Originally Posted by DD GT3 RD
I was at the track with 2 peytron cup cars and it seemed they ran a stock center muffler with NO side mufflers.

Cup cars and road going GT3's run different mufflers.

The only thing the same is the overall size and tip location.

The cup car muffler is baffled different than the road car version.
